Woman crashes car into south Charlotte restaurant

By Elisabeth Arriero
earriero@charlotteobserver.com

Emergency crews were called to a south Charlotte restaurant after a woman drove straight through the front of the business on Wednesday afternoon.

Medic was called to the scene after the green sedan crashed into Portofino’s at the Arboretum. The incident took place around 4:30 p.m. at 8128 Providence Road.

Raffaele Guardascione, a manager at the restaurant, said he was making bread for the night when he heard a “big explosion, like the glass breaking.”

An elderly woman had driven up on the curb, through the wrought iron fence surrounding the restaurant’s patio and through the front of the restaurant.

Guardascione checked to make sure the woman was alright and turned off the car, which was still in drive.

The woman told him that she thought she was in reverse rather than drive, he said.

“Boom. Next thing you know she’s in our restaurant,” said Guardascione. “It’s a lot of damage. We threw away a lot of food in the trash because there was glass everywhere.”

The restaurant, which opened on July 8, may not be opened until next week due to the damage, he said.

The woman was transported from the vehicle around 4:50 p.m. and walked away on her own power.
